Dan and Carmen are hip, healthy and wealthy. They have their own companies, plenty of money and friends and are the proud parents of one year-old Luna...They live the cool life in...
more...Amsterdam, until beautiful and optimistic Carmen is diagnosed with breast cancer. With that their world transforms into a roller-coaster ride of doctors and hospitals. As his way of coping, the hedonistic Dan faithfully accompanies Carmen to her chemo and radiotherapy treatments, but spends his nocturnal hours crazily immersed in the nightlife and women of Amsterdam and Miami. "Love Life" is the account of a relationship and a terminal illness, devoid of fake sentiment and told with humour and deep humanity. And it is very much an ode to love. 'A wonderful novel about courage, helplessness and real love' - "Cosmopolitan Germany".

Full review
The cover of this book doesn't really give anythig away as to what lies in store for the reader and it wouln't really jump out at you in the book store. But do not be foole, it's a fantastic novel.

Here we meet Dan and Carmen a successful couple living in Amsterdam and, apart from Dan's indicretions, they are quite a happy little family with their young daughter Luna. That all changes when they find out Carmen has breast cancer.

The novel is written from Dan's perspective and eventhough he is a total philanderer you can't help but like they guy although you will often feel torn between him and how Carmen is feeling.
If your thinking this novel will be depressing it's actually quite he opposite it's got some real funny moments and I love the way Ray kluun has included quotations from films and songs.

The chapters are really short and I didn't really understand why at first but it later becomes apparent that you nay need to put it down quite often to wipe away the tears.

Tha characters are fantastically written Carman is amazing, Dan is a lovable rougue and Dan's friends and colleagues are all different but likable at the same time. The relationships are real, rather than chick lit nonscence.

Ray Kluun has wriiten this novel as fiction (so don't know why it's listed in non fiction) but we know that it is based on his experience of when his wife was diagnosed with breast cancer, although I wouldn't like to gues how much is fact and how much is fiction.

Everbody should read this. it's an absolute gem. Will warm your heart then break it at the same time.
